DOOM/DOOM 2 (Req. 386 DX, 4mb Ram, VGA. Sound card recommended.) Reviewed by Michael Raven. Doom, although rather outdated now, is still one of the best games available for the PC. For anyone not aware of Doom, (ha!) it is a first-person perspective shoot-em-up. Or, you see what your person sees. You go around a number of levels, blasting apart enemies from your own buddies, now on the enemy side, to huge spider demons, firing chainguns at you. From 7 weapons, from a punch to a 'BFG 9000', a slow-firing gun that can kill almost anything with one shot, you have a large selection of weaponry to kill with! Huge amounts of player-created levels, sounds, graphics, patches for new weapons & monsters, anything thought of for Doom, is around somewhere. With cheat modes allowing you to learn the basics, you can sidestep, run, walk, and blast the enemy into nothing. And if that gets boring, a quick link-up to a network, or even to just one other computer will get you into a cooperative game, or a deathmatch, where you fight to the death, only to be reincarnated to fight again. With excellent playability, (if you die, it's your mistake - not the game's!) marvellous graphics and sound, plus a moodiness to scare you out of your wits when a cacodemon blasts you apart from behind, it's an excellent game, with very little in my estimation to recommend Quake over it.
